    Let \(\mathcal{R}_D\) denote the (finite) set of rational two-dimensional planes of discriminant \(D\) in \(\mathbb{R}^4\). To any such plane one can attach a point on the Grassmannian \(\mathrm{Gr}(2,4)\) together with four shapes of rank-two lattices. The authors conjecture that as \(D \to \infty\) the set of all such combinations becomes equidistributed to the uniform measure in the suitable product space. The conjecture is then proved under the assumption of two additional congruence conditions. A key ingredient in the proofs is a set of recent results by \textit{M. Einsiedler} and \textit{E. Lindenstrauss} [Publ. Math., Inst. Hautes Étud. Sci. 129, 83--127 (2019; Zbl 1423.22014)] on the classification of joinings.
